[Agora Report] 2014 Excavations

Agora Excavations Preliminary Report - Summer 2014 ... John McK. Camp II ... Excavations in 2014 were carried out in three sections: ΒΘ, ΒΓ and ΒΖ. In Section ΒΘ, overlying the Painted Stoa, the Byzantine houses of the 11th century A.D. were further exposed in the western part ... 9 Jun-1 Aug 2014 ... The eastern half was dug deeper; a pithos discovered at a lower level suggests an earlier phase of the Byzantine settlement. ... Two skeletons were found along with pottery and beads from a necklace. In Section ΒΓ, the exploration of the Panathenaic Way continued. ... In Classical levels, numerous post-holes of various sizes and depths were dug. A large number of images of Section ΒΘ were taken with the use of a drone.

[Agora Report] 2019 Excavations

Agora 2019 - Summary Report ... John McK. Camp II ... Excavations were carried out in four sections: in Section ΝΝ in the southwest corner of the archaeological site, and in the northwest corner of the Agora in Sections ΒΖ, ΒΘ East and ΒΘ West. Section ΝΝ ... 10 Jun-2 Aug 2019 ... Excavations took place in an area where a deposit of terracotta figurines had been found in the 1940’s. ... One more pithos was found and others were explored. ... North of the tank, a corner of a marble bench or seat was uncovered.
